Today we're excited to launch phase 1 of the site redesign, which includes an all-new dark theme and functionality updates to some of the pages. To access the beta, visit the Edit Account page then navigate to the Beta submenu and click the opt-in button.

In addition to the design changes, some new features we've added in this phase of the beta are:

- A new mosaic view for displaying achievements on the game pages

- A new page to list all achievements you've earned (accessible by clicking "All achievements" on a profile page).

- Ability to view full-sized images of achievements icons (for platforms that support it, only Xbox One / Windows 10 games offer larger images for now).

Let us know if you experience any issues. We haven't fully optimized the beta for mobile yet, so we're aware of some issues there. Next phase will focus on additional features such as the guide system and following users.
